Comparison

Cursor vs Windsurf

Cursor vs Windsurf is a comparison between two AI-forward coding environments, but the buying decision is really about workflow style. Cursor tends to appeal more to power users who want depth, while Windsurf often feels more approachable for developers exploring AI-native editing.

Quick winner summary

Choose Cursor if you want the stronger power-user environment. Choose Windsurf if you want an easier on-ramp into AI-native coding and still plan to test how central it will become.

Who wins by use case

Deep refactoring and codebase work

Cursor

Cursor is usually the stronger fit when developers want more context-aware editing and serious implementation help.

Experimenting with modern AI coding workflows

Windsurf

Windsurf is appealing for developers who want an AI-first editor without immediately optimizing for maximum depth.

Advanced AI-assisted development

Cursor

Cursor more often becomes the tool of choice when AI is central to how the developer ships code.

Side-by-side comparison table

labeltoolAtoolBwinner
Best forcodebase-aware editing and refactoring supportAI-assisted coding flow and fast code generationCursor
Standout strengthagentic coding help and codebase contextAI editing and code generationDepends
Pricing modelPaidFreemiumWindsurf
Free planNoYesWindsurf
Ease of useAI-native coding environment for deeper implementation and refactoring support.Modern coding assistant for AI editing, generation, and faster implementation.Depends

Feature comparison

Cursor is strongest when the workflow depends on codebase-aware editing and refactoring support. Windsurf is stronger when the real goal is AI-assisted coding flow and fast code generation. That is why this decision usually comes down to workflow fit more than a generic idea of which model is “better”.

If you are shopping inside AI Coding Tools, pay most attention to how quickly each product gets to a usable result and how much review it creates after the first draft.

Ease of use comparison

Cursor feels easier when cursor is usually the stronger fit when developers want more context-aware editing and serious implementation help. Because it is a paid-first product, the best test is a short, focused trial against real work.

Windsurf is the stronger choice when windsurf is appealing for developers who want an AI-first editor without immediately optimizing for maximum depth. Buyers should judge ease of use by how well the tool matches the daily job, not by how simple the landing page looks.

Pricing comparison

Cursor uses a paid model without a meaningful free tier, while Windsurf uses a freemium model with free access available. The pricing question matters most after you know which tool actually fits the workflow.

Which tool should you choose?

Choose Cursor if the winning use case is deep refactoring and codebase work. Choose Windsurf if the shortlist is really about experimenting with modern AI coding workflows. If you want a broader shortlist before deciding, continue with Best AI tools for developers and Best AI tools for coding.

Decision highlights

  • Cursor is the better fit for deep refactoring and codebase work.
  • Windsurf is stronger for experimenting with modern AI coding workflows.
  • This comparison is most useful for buyers who already have a shortlist and need a cleaner recommendation by workflow.

Watchouts

  • Generated code still needs review, testing, and architectural judgment.
  • The wrong choice usually comes from matching the tool to hype instead of the actual workflow.
  • Pricing only becomes meaningful once you know the tool will be used repeatedly.

FAQ

Which is better: Cursor or Windsurf?

Choose Cursor if you want the stronger power-user environment. Choose Windsurf if you want an easier on-ramp into AI-native coding and still plan to test how central it will become.

Which tool is easier for beginners?

The tool with the clearer free starting point often wins for beginners, but workflow fit still matters more than price alone.

How should I choose between Cursor and Windsurf?

Choose based on the workflow you repeat most often. If the same task shows up every week, the better product is the one that gets to a usable result faster with less cleanup.

Do I still need to review the output?

Generated code still needs review, testing, and architectural judgment.

Read the individual reviews

AI Coding Tools

Cursor

AI-native coding environment for deeper implementation and refactoring support.

Paid Paid plan required
FeaturedTrending
codebase-aware editingrefactoring supportAI-first development flow

AI Coding Tools

Windsurf

Modern coding assistant for AI editing, generation, and faster implementation.

Freemium Free plan available
Trending
AI-assisted coding flowfast code generationdeveloper experimentation

Related best-of pages

Related category hubs

Category

AI Coding Tools

AI coding tools support code completion, debugging, refactoring, codebase search, and implementation speed inside real development workflows.